Package: PKbioanalysis 0.2.0

Omar Elashkar

PKbioanalysis: Pharmacokinetic Bioanalysis Experiments Design and Exploration

Automate pharmacokinetic/pharmacodynamic bioanalytical procedures based on best practices and regulatory recommendations. The package impose regulatory constrains and sanity checking for common bioanalytical procedures. Additionally, 'PKbioanalysis' provides a relational infrastructure for plate management and injection sequence.

Authors:Omar Elashkar [aut, cre]

PKbioanalysis_0.2.0.tar.gz
PKbioanalysis_0.2.0.zip(r-4.5)PKbioanalysis_0.2.0.zip(r-4.4)PKbioanalysis_0.2.0.zip(r-4.3)
PKbioanalysis_0.2.0.tgz(r-4.5-any)PKbioanalysis_0.2.0.tgz(r-4.4-any)PKbioanalysis_0.2.0.tgz(r-4.3-any)
PKbioanalysis_0.2.0.tar.gz(r-4.5-noble)PKbioanalysis_0.2.0.tar.gz(r-4.4-noble)
PKbioanalysis_0.2.0.tgz(r-4.4-emscripten)PKbioanalysis_0.2.0.tgz(r-4.3-emscripten)
PKbioanalysis.pdf |PKbioanalysis.html
PKbioanalysis/json (API)
NEWS

# Install 'PKbioanalysis' in R:
install.packages('PKbioanalysis', repos = c('https://omarashkar.r-universe.dev', 'https://cloud.r-project.org'))

Bug tracker:https://github.com/omarashkar/pkbioanalysis/issues

On CRAN:

Conda:

4.40 score 4 scripts 162 downloads 18 exports 99 dependencies

Last updated 5 months agofrom:142ed84472. Checks:1 OK, 8 NOTE. Indexed: yes.

TargetResultLatest binary
Doc / VignettesOKMar 04 2025
R-4.5-winNOTEMar 04 2025
R-4.5-macNOTEMar 04 2025
R-4.5-linuxNOTEMar 04 2025
R-4.4-winNOTEMar 04 2025
R-4.4-macNOTEMar 04 2025
R-4.4-linuxNOTEMar 04 2025
R-4.3-winNOTEMar 04 2025
R-4.3-macNOTEMar 04 2025

Exports:add_blankadd_cs_curveadd_DBadd_qcsadd_samplesadd_samples_cadd_suitabilitybuild_injec_seqcombine_injec_listscombine_platesdownload_sample_listgenerate_96make_calibration_studymake_metabolic_studyplate_appplate_metadataregister_platewrite_injec_seq

Dependencies:backportsbase64encbitbit64bsiconsbslibcachemcheckmateclicliprcolorspacecommonmarkcpp11crayoncrosstalkDBIDiagrammeRdigestdplyrDTduckdbevaluatefansifarverfastmapfontawesomefsgenericsggforceggplot2gluegtablehighrhmshtmltoolshtmlwidgetshttpuvigraphisobandjquerylibjsonliteknitrlabelinglaterlatticelazyevallifecyclemagrittrMASSMatrixmemoisemgcvmimemunsellnlmepillarpkgconfigpolyclipprettyunitsprogresspromisespurrrR6rappdirsRColorBrewerRcppRcppEigenreadrrhandsontablerlangrmarkdownrstudioapisassscalesshinyshinyalertshinyjsshinyWidgetssourcetoolsstringistringrsystemfontstibbletidyrtidyselecttinytextweenrtzdbunitsutf8uuidvctrsviridisLitevisNetworkvroomwithrxfunxtableyaml

PKbioanalysis overview

Rendered fromPKbioanalysis_overview.Rmdusingknitr::rmarkdownon Mar 04 2025.

Last update: 2024-10-02
Started: 2024-09-09

Readme and manuals

Help Manual

Help pageTopics
Subsetting method for MultiPlate[[,MultiPlate-method
Add blank to the plate Can be either double blank (DB), CS0IS+ or CS1IS-add_blank
Add calibration curve to the plateadd_cs_curve
Add double blank (DB) to a plateadd_DB
Add quality control samples to the plateadd_qcs
Add unknown samples to a plateadd_samples
Cartesian product of sample factors to a plateadd_samples_c
Add suitability sample to the plateadd_suitability
Create Injection Sequencebuild_injec_seq
Create Injection Sequence from MultiPlate (Multiple Plates)build_injec_seq,MultiPlate-method
Create Injection Sequence from PlateObj (Single Plate)build_injec_seq,PlateObj-method
Create Sample List with rigorous designcombine_injec_lists
Combine plates in MultiPlate objectcombine_plates
Download sample list from database to local spreadsheetdownload_sample_list
Generate 96 Plate Generate a typical 96 well plate. User need to specify the empty rows which a going to be used across the experiment.generate_96
Length method for MultiPlatelength,MultiPlate-method
Create a calibration study with calibration standards and QCsmake_calibration_study
Create a metabolic study layoutmake_metabolic_study
bioanalytic_appplate_app
Set plate descriptionplate_metadata
Plotting 96 well plateplot.PlateObj
Register a plate This will save the plate to the databaseregister_plate
Register a multiple plates at onceregister_plate,MultiPlate-method
Register a plate This will save the plate to the databaseregister_plate,PlateObj-method
Export injection sequence to vendor specific formatwrite_injec_seq